2010 Photo contest open to photojournalists worldwide (deadline January 14)

Photojournalists and professional photographers are invited to submit works to the 2010 World Press Photo contest. Deadline for submissions: January 14, 2010.

Entries may be entered as single images or stories/portfolios in ten categories: Spot News, General News, People in the News, Sports Action, Sports Feature, Contemporary Issues, Daily Life, Portraits, Arts and Entertainment and Nature.

Winning pictures will compose a traveling exhibition in more than 90 locations worldwide. In the 2009 World Press Photo Contest, 96,268 images were submitted by 5,508 photographers from 124 countries, according to the contest organizers.

CIWEM Environmental Photographer of the Year Competition

CIWEM (The Chartered Institution of Water and Environmental Management) runs the Environmental Photographer of the Year, which is one of the fastest growing photographic competitions in the world. In 2009 we received nearly 2,500 entries from photographers in over 60 countries.

This is a serious competition that seeks to celebrate photographers who use their ability to raise awareness of environmental and social issues. It is open to all professional and amateur international photographers of any ages and encourages entries that are contemporary, creative, experimental, resonant, original and beautiful.

The 2010 categories are:

Mott MacDonald's Changing Climates
The Natural World
Quality of Life
Innovation in the Environment (New)
The Underwater World (New)

Job: Collections Manager at The Wende Museum (Los Angeles)

THE WENDE MUSEUM was founded in 2002 to ensure that a comprehensive record of life, expression, and political developments in Eastern Europe and the Soviet Union during the Cold War is preserved and accessible. Located in Culver City, CA, the Wende actively acquires and conserves artifacts, personal histories, and documentary materials, presents exhibitions and programs, and promotes scholarship and education. Job opportunity at the Los Angeles Opera

Assistant Director of Development, Major Gifts

The Los Angeles Opera has an exciting opportunity for an Assistant Director of Development, Major Gifts who will be responsible for overseeing the patron program and implementing various strategies to acquire new donors and renewals of gifts. Some activities will include hosting meals with donors and prospects, attending performances, and otherwise representing the L.A. Opera in a positive fashion to the donor community.

Qualified candidates will have a BA or BS degree in a related field or equivalent experience in addition to at least 5 years of experience in development, especially for a non-profit arts organization. This position must be prepared to work nights and weekends as needed.
